CC seat in Train explained
CC stands for AC Chair Car. It is a comfy seat on a train that is cool and great for daytime travel. Knowing the different seating classes can improve your train journey. CC or Chair Car offers comfy seats for short to medium trips. Let’s see what CC in trains is and what it offers.

Features and Amenities
Seat Arrangement:
CC class seats are arranged in a 3 x 2 per row layout like airplane seats. They are designed for comfort with enough legroom. Small tables are attached to the seats for keeping belongings or eating.
Amenities:
Most CC class trains are air-conditioned so you can travel in comfort even in hot weather. They also have reading lights charging points luggage space and other amenities.

Availability and Booking Seats
CC seats are available on most trains including intercity and Shatabdi trains. You can book a CC ticket easily through the Indian Railways website or at railway stations.
What are CC and EC seats in Train?
CC and EC (Executive Chair Car) are both classes of seating in trains. While CC is more budget-friendly and offers basic amenities, EC is a higher class with more luxurious seating and additional amenities.
Difference Between CC and EC in Train
The main difference is comfort and amenities. EC coaches have more spacious and comfy seats. They also offer extra amenities like meals and drinks during the journey.
FAQs Related to CC Coach in Train:-
Which is better CC or EC in Train?
It depends on what you prefer and your budget. If you want a cheaper option, CC is good. If you want more comfort and luxury, EC is better.
Is CC a Sleeper Coach?
No, CC is not a sleeper coach. It has comfortable chairs for sitting during the journey.
Is CC Comfortable on the Train?
CC coaches are quite comfortable. The seats are not as luxurious as EC but are good for short to medium trips.
